Marketing Assistant - South Africa

Location: Remote
Hourly Salary: $6.10
Contract: 37.5 hrs
Line Manager: Wendy Pienaar
Recruiter:Will Daniels

You’ll be responsible for helping to maintain and develop Twinkl’s thriving online community for South Africa. Your time will be spent working on creating content for our social media platforms, outreach, coming up with innovative ideas and new ways to engage with and grow these communities, and reaching people beyond them. You’ll be able to use your creativity to create innovative, engaging content to showcase our current Twinkl resources and products in inspirational ways to our followers.

Who are we looking for?

A hustler! Someone who can pull rabbits out of hats and is execution focused. A creative thinker, clever and witty - a natural marketeer who can spot and execute opportunities each day and who can lead and motivate those within their team to do the same. Whether this be through day-to-day activities, or leading on larger campaigns, we’re looking for a candidate who can deliver each time.

Your weekly activity could include:

  • Outreaching to other groups, influencers and partnerships
  • Developing innovative ideas for marketing campaigns and projects
  • Developing new ways to engage and grow different social media platforms
  • Creating original social media content - engagement posts, assets, creative visuals, user gen, videos, blogs, newsletters etc
  • Developing new channels to market
  • Supporting others with their innovative ideas
  • Spotting trends within the South African market and beyond, and being able to respond/ pivot quickly to make the most of these trends.
  • Interacting with customers on social media platforms, being the voice of Twinkl South Africa and offering advice and support where needed
  • Building up the social media channels and increasing our following
  • Copywriting for social media feed posts
  • Scheduling content for publishing
  • Gathering insights from our community to share with your team

To succeed in the role, you will:

  • Be able to spot and execute opportunities consistently - each and every day
  • Be a fantastic communicator who thrives when working in a close-knit team.
  • Have excellent spelling and grammar.
  • Be passionate about using social media to create strong and supportive communities.
  • Be able to work under own initiative with minimum supervision but also as part of a team
  • Be organised and adaptive, able to work to tight deadlines and manage your time effectively.
  • Be able to work collaboratively

In this role, you gain:

  • Experience of working in a fast-paced environment
  • Opportunities to show innovation and work on self-directed social media projects
  • Opportunities to develop graphic design skills for producing social media content
  • Experience working with Facebook, Instagram, TikTok, Twitter, Pinterest and having the opportunity to create new marketing channels on platforms we haven’t explored yet.

You’ll work with:

You’ll be part of the South African team, a fast-growing and dynamic team who focus on developing the South African market within Twinkl. The South African team is made up of a great group of people who are focused on helping those who teach in South Africa. We are a friendly and fun team who put innovation at the forefront of everything we do.

Requirements

We're interested in anyone who meets one, or a combination of the following:

  • You have a great working knowledge of Adobe Photoshop/InDesign.
  • You have a good understanding of how to edit videos, to be on trend with the world.
  • You have experience in marketing or running your own social media accounts.
  • You have previous experience running social media channels for a small business.
  • Willing to be flexible around working times. Being able to work half your working week during weekends and evenings. Hours can be agreed upon between you and your line manager to work office hours.
  • Is fluent in English as well as one other South African language.
